Troubleshooting order placement error
If you encounter an error message stating “Something went wrong when trying to place your order.”, it means the following:
- The order submission failed due to a browser or security-related issue, often because the required reCAPTCHA verification did not load or complete successfully.
This issue typically occurs when:
- A pop-up blocker or browser extension is preventing the reCAPTCHA from loading.
- Browser settings are blocking third-party cookies required for verification.
- Network or firewall restrictions are interfering with reCAPTCHA services.
How to troubleshoot payment error something went wrong when trying to place your order
Do the following to troubleshoot:
- Disable pop-up blockers
Turn off any pop-up blockers in your browser settings and allow pop-ups for the checkout site to ensure required windows can open. - Disable browser extensions
Temporarily disable all browser extensions, especially ad blockers, privacy tools, and script blockers, as these can interfere with reCAPTCHA loading. - Check for reCAPTCHA visibility
Ensure that the reCAPTCHA checkbox or challenge appears on the checkout page. If it does not appear, your browser is likely blocking required scripts. - Allow third-party cookies
Enable third-party cookies in your browser settings, as reCAPTCHA requires cookies from external domains to function properly. - Retry in a private browsing window
Open an Incognito or Private browsing window (with extensions disabled) and attempt the order again. - Update billing information
Before retrying, review and update your billing details in the billing portal to ensure all information is complete and accurate. - Try a different browser
Switch to another browser, such as Google Chrome or Mozilla Firefox, to rule out browser-specific issues. - Check network restrictions
If you are using a corporate or restricted network, verify with your IT team that reCAPTCHA-related domains are not being blocked by firewall or security settings.
